Batteries and Capacitors
There are two types of electric buses: battery electric buses and capacitor vehicles, which use supercapacitors (ultracapacitors) to store electricity. Fuel Cells and Hydrogen
Hydrogen is the fuel used by fuel cells in order to generate the electricity needed to power buses. The generated electricity can be stored in batteries on board the bus. Hydrogen fuel cell buses are an emerging technology in response to decarbonisation efforts as well as goals to reduce emissions within built-up areas.
